Sen. Hirono & All4Ed CEO Amy Loyd Stand Up for Students
On Dec. 16th U.S. Senator Mazie K. Hirono (D-HI) held a spotlight forum titled, โDismantling Education: What the Trump Administrationโs Illegal Attacks on Federal Programs Mean for Students, Families, and Educators,โ highlighting the dangerous consequences of the Trump Administrationโs efforts to dismantle the U.S. Department of Education (ED) for our nationโs students, families, educators, and schoolsโamong others.
During the forum, a panel of witnesses comprised of K-12 education leaders and civil rights experts spoke about how abolishing the Department of Education and moving these programs to other federal agencies would harm students across the country, especially those who come from low-income, rural, Native, migrant, and federally-impacted communities.
